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
830263060 54 830290831 86753878
9731182 4194
9731182 4194
7375 40968 5163 080 234
All about undefined
Interested in learning more?
9731182 4194
7375 40968 5163 080 234
See more
004526 52
102077558 0970426 504058490 8263
See more
3476275347 051 759174
921 5422134 77403029
See more